ZIP Code 18603: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in ZIP Code 18603?
The median home value in ZIP Code 18603 is $170,500, lower than 60%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much is property tax in ZIP Code 18603?
The median annual property tax in ZIP Code 18603 is $2,004,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
Is ZIP Code 18603 expensive to live in?
Homes in ZIP Code 18603 cost about 2.83× the median household income, near the U.S. ZIP codes median.
What is the average rent in ZIP Code 18603?
The median gross rent in ZIP Code 18603 is $810 a month, lower than 59%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much have home prices grown in ZIP Code 18603?
Home prices in ZIP Code 18603 have moved 57% over the past five years (14% in the past year), per the FHFA House Price Index.
What is the weather like in ZIP Code 18603?
ZIP Code 18603 averages 47.6°F year-round, summer highs near 78.1°F, winter lows around 18.5°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 35.6 inches of snow a year.
Is ZIP Code 18603 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
ZIP Code 18603's FEMA National Risk Index score is 70 (higher than 56% of U.S. ZIP codes).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is tornado.
